跳到主要内容

版本:5.X

搜索会话(Electron)

本文档仅适用于 Electron 解决方案,仅限于配合 Electron 模块 (@rongcloud/electron@rongcloud/electron-renderer)使用。

本文档仅描述了如何从客户端本地搜索会话。

搜索本地会话

提示

从 SDK 5.4.0 开始支持该接口。

调用 electronExtension.searchConversationByContent 根据消息内容搜索本地会话列表。

const keyword = '<keyword>'
const messageTypes = [RongIMLib.MessageType.TEXT]
RongIMLib.electronExtension.searchConversationByContent(keyword, messageTypes).then(res => {
if (res.code === 0) {
console.log(res.code, res.data)
} else {
console.log(res.code, res.msg)
}
})
参数类型必填说明
keywordstring搜索关键字
messageTypesstring[]消息类型
channelIdstring频道Id,不传则获取全部频道 ID 类型